What is a modified atmosphere packaging machine?
The modified atmosphere packing machine alters the composition of gases within the package—such as oxygen, carbon dioxide, and nitrogen. This process inhibits microbial growth and retards food oxidation.
Consequently, the MAP machine is widely utilized in sectors involving fresh foods, cooked products, fruits and vegetables, and meat processing.
Enhance freshness and extend product shelf life
The most prominent advantage of the modified atmosphere packing machine lies in its ability to significantly extend the shelf life of food products. By reducing oxygen levels and increasing the proportion of carbon dioxide, they effectively inhibit bacterial proliferation and oxidative reactions.
For businesses, this translates into:
- Reduced product spoilage rates
- Extended sales cycles
- Alleviated pressure on cold chain logistics
This advantage is particularly pronounced in the context of long-distance transportation or export trade.


Preserve appearance and texture of food
While traditional vacuum packaging can extend shelf life, it often causes food to become compressed and deformed, thereby compromising its visual appeal. Conversely, modified atmosphere packaging enables effective preservation without compromising the product’s structural integrity. For instance:
- Fresh meats retain their natural color.
- Fruits and vegetables are protected from collapsing and moisture loss.
- Cooked foods preserve their original taste and texture.
This holds significant importance in enhancing a product’s competitiveness within the market.

Wide scope of application
The modified atmosphere packing machine possesses exceptional adaptability, allowing for the adjustment of gas mixtures according to different food types to meet diverse packaging requirements. For instance:
- Meat products: High-oxygen or low-oxygen modified atmosphere schemes
- Fruits and vegetables: Low-oxygen, high-nitrogen environments
- Baked goods: Mold prevention and freshness preservation
